I

think I need some help with the math here...

If I want to dilute an essential oil mix in a carrier oil every

book I have read recommends a 5% mix, but I have read several different ways of making this 5% which confuses

me:

One source said that I should take 100 ml carrier oil and mix it with 5 ml essential oil, thus making it

5 % since 5 ml / 100 ml = 0.05 = 5 %.

Another source said that 95 ml carrier oil and 5 ml essential oil give

a 5 % solution.

I am inclined to accept the latter, since the *whole* volume is 100 ml and 5 ml of this 100ml

is essential oil, thus 5% dilution.

Do I assume correctly or am I just stupid?
